The popular eCommerce platform, eBay, also has its affiliate marketplace for vehicles, called eBay Motors

You have two options to sell your car through eBay Motors: 

  1. You can list your car to have people buy them for the price you set. 
  2. Alternatively, you can auction your used car on the platform, and your vehicle will go to the highest bidder.

Either option is excellent if you’re looking to sell your used car for the maximum price. 

Just note that when selling through eBay Motors, you’ll be responsible for choosing the shipping option, fees, and payment methods.

CarGurus is an online platform that connects private vehicle buyers and sellers. On its website, you can list your car for $4.95 and market to its more than 30 million audiences. 

Once you get a buyer for your vehicle, CarGurus will handle the pick-up and shipping. That way, you need not stress over getting your car to your buyer. 

CarGurus also handles payment through their secured channel. It also offers payment protection of up to $75,000, guaranteeing you’ll get paid. After the buyer receives your car, CarGurus will send you payment within 3 business days.

Cars and Bids is an auction website that caters to car buyers and sellers. The selling process here is optimized to provide sellers with the highest profits. Cars and Bids advertise free listing fees and low fees when your car finally sells. 

Unlike other companies on this list, Cars and Bids reviews all listings sent to them. In short, your used car needs to pass their standards before Cars and Bids lists it on their platform and makes it available for auction. 

Considering how it works, the company ensures you’ll only get legit buyers on the platform.
